Volkswagen Tiguan 1.4 TSI MT Trend & Fun (2013) vs Isuzu D-Max 3.0 LS-E 4×4 AT (2021): which should you buy?

For a Filipino buyer deciding between the Volkswagen Tiguan 1.4 TSI MT Trend & Fun (2013) and the Isuzu D-Max 3.0 LS-E 4×4 AT (2021), the choice hinges on use case. The Tiguan is a compact SUV priced at ₱1,740,000, offering a car-like driving experience with a 1.4L turbo gas engine (122 PS, 200 Nm), front-wheel drive, and a 6-speed manual. However, it's a discontinued 2013 model with a 2-year warranty, and its lower torque and FWD limit off-road and heavy-load capability. In contrast, the D-Max is a newer 2021 pickup truck at ₱1,825,000, boasting a robust 3.0L turbo diesel engine (190 PS, 450 Nm), 4WD, and an automatic transmission. It provides superior towing, hauling, and rough-road performance, plus better fuel efficiency for diesel. The D-Max is ideal for buyers who need a workhorse or off-road vehicle, while the Tiguan suits those prioritizing a lower price, sporty handling, and city commuting. Given the age and manual gearbox of the Tiguan, the D-Max's modern features and versatility make it the better long-term value for most Filipino families or businesses.

Frequently asked questions

Which vehicle is cheaper?

The Volkswagen Tiguan is cheaper at ₱1,740,000 compared to the Isuzu D-Max at ₱1,825,000, a difference of ₱85,000.

Which vehicle has more power and torque?

The Isuzu D-Max is more powerful with 190 PS and 450 Nm of torque, versus the Tiguan's 122 PS and 200 Nm.

Which is better for daily commuting?

The Tiguan, being a compact SUV with a car-like ride, is generally better for daily city driving, but it has a manual transmission. The D-Max is automatic and newer but larger; fuel economy data is not provided for either, so a direct comparison is not possible.

Which vehicle is more suitable for off-road or heavy-duty use?

The Isuzu D-Max is far more suitable for off-road and heavy-duty use, thanks to its 4WD drivetrain, high torque (450 Nm), and diesel engine, making it ideal for towing and rough terrain.
